Brazilian steel manufacturer Gerdau experienced a marginal increase in its adjusted net profit during the fourth quarter. The company reported a 0.5% rise, bringing the total to 670 billion reais.
Despite the overall profit growth, Gerdau's adjusted earnings before interest, taxes, depreciation, and amortization (EBITDA) saw a slight decline. This figure decreased by 0.7% compared to the same period in the previous year, settling at 2.37 billion reais. This performance was largely in line with analyst expectations.
